The dome was great! The AC worked well, but surprisingly we hardly needed it even though it was 100 degrees out during the day. There were lots of useful amenities like microwave, fridge, knives, plates, keurig, etc. The view was beautiful and we felt completely secluded.
It was not quite as nice as we thought it would be, it seemed like we were in a construction zone/project still; outside was not quite tidy. We were bummed there ware only 2 towels available when we booked it, we said there would be 4 of us. Also, it was very hot in the dome when we got there, the air conditioner/cooler was not working but I was able to figure out the ground fault breaker has to be reset.
Overall not bad and felt clean enough but we felt it could be a little better executed.
Fun experience! No check in, your code was emailed and texted to you. Linens and towels were provided. Heater worked well but it set the fire alarm off. Rooster will wake you up at dawn. Deer roam the property
The dome itself was ok, but I was not aware that the bathrooms were OUTSIDE the dome. If i had known, I would not have booked. The bed was terribly uncomfortable and soft, very bad for people with back problems. The hosts were okay, pretty fast to respond when I needed something. Its a nice spot if you want a VERY rustic experience. I will NOT be coming back.
These domes were an above and beyond experience, from beautiful decor to items left in the kitchen to make the stay more comfortable, these domes were well built and thought out! The bed was comfortable, there was heat/AC, gas fireplace outside, bbq and a nice bathroom. It was so peaceful to sit in comfortable chairs and look out over the landscape. We would definitely stay here again and recommend to anyone!
Amazing views. Gas firepit needs some repair but does work if you fiddle with it. (Ignitor button is broken).
We did enjoy it... very cool experience.

The domes were unique and as stated inside.
Not air-conditioned but swamp cooler.
Domes close together with no flat area outside to sit and enjoy nature.
Dome tents were a unique experience. Comfortable and roomy. Nice to be close to the ground. Good to have private bath but it was a walk out of the tent that you got used to.
Our experience at the Domes was great. We did have a small hickup with the water pump in our restroom, but the camp hosts fixed is in lighting speed. The site was very peaceful and the dome was wonderful. There was a heater and swamp cooler that both worked well. The vinyl on the windows could have been a bit more clear for improved views of the beautiful site. Note that Domes 1-5 have detached restrooms w/showers, but they are still private to your dome number which was nice. We are used to tent camping so this was definitely a wonderful glamping experience.
